Press Conference on Position Announcement on the 1st
"We Will Fight Against Acts Undermining the Constitutional Order"
"We Will Play a Role for the Success of the Yoon Government"
Lee Dong-kwan, Chairman of the Korea Communications Commission, officially announced his resignation on the 1st ahead of the National Assembly's impeachment vote. He strongly criticized the opposition, saying, "They are abusing the National Assembly's authority and recklessly issuing impeachments."
On the same day, Chairman Lee held a press conference at the Government Complex Gwacheon and said, "As of today, I resign from the position of Chairman of the Korea Communications Commission," adding, "This is neither due to pressure from the ruling party nor a political trick as claimed by the opposition." He further stated, "It is solely out of loyalty to the country and the appointing authority, the President."
He explained, "If the impeachment motion proceeds, it is uncertain how many months it will take until the judgment is made," and added, "During that time, the Korea Communications Commission will effectively be in a vegetative state, and the National Assembly will be paralyzed amid the ruling and opposition parties' disputes. It is the duty of a public official to avoid this situation even if it means sacrificing myself."
He continued, "The public is already well aware of the unfairness of the impeachment pushed by the major opposition party," emphasizing, "I will continue to expose the illegitimacy of the Democratic Party's abuse of constitutional order by recklessly issuing impeachments through the abuse of the National Assembly's authority and fight against it."
Finally, he stated, "Wherever I am, I will do my part for South Korea's leap to becoming a global media powerhouse and the success of the Yoon Suk-yeol administration," and added, "The train of media normalization will continue to run."
Earlier, President Yoon Suk-yeol accepted Chairman Lee's resignation. It was reported that Chairman Lee personally called President Yoon the day before to express his voluntary resignation.
